ADVICE

Use Docket Power To Quash Fringe Claims Early

  • Courts should use docket control to prevent harmful ideas from percolating and becoming normalized.
  • Leah urges the Court could have issued a spare opinion earlier to reject the theory instead of letting it fester.
INSIGHT

Selective Living Constitutionalism Undermines Consistency

  • Justices selectively embrace living‑constitutional ideas when convenient, undermining doctrinal consistency.
  • Leah criticizes Alito's claim that changed circumstances (e.g., modern migration) nullify original 14th Amendment meanings.
